About This Color

PANTONE P 73-3 U is a highly saturated red with bright tonality. Its HEX value is #F2ABBA, placing it in the red region of the color spectrum with a hue angle of 347°.

This lighter shade is well-suited for backgrounds, accent areas, and designs that require an open, airy feel. It pairs naturally with darker neutrals for contrast.
